How can a tutor effectively teach a physical instrument like the violin online?

It works brilliantly! Using high-quality video calls, tutors can demonstrate techniques like bow grip and posture with perfect clarity. They can hear intonation and rhythm just as they would in person and provide immediate, specific feedback. Plus, features like screen sharing for music sheets make it a really interactive and effective way to learn.

What equipment do we need for an online violin lesson?

It's simple. Your child will need their violin and bow, a laptop, tablet or computer with a webcam and microphone, and a stable internet connection. That's it! Your tutor will handle the rest.

How often should my child have a lesson?

Most students have one lesson per week, as this provides a great balance of new learning and time for personal practice. However, the schedule is completely flexible. You can arrange sessions more or less frequently to suit your child's goals and your family's routine.
